Background

Drop-in daycare facilities initially begun to gain popularity during the early 2000s as a reply towards switching requirements of modern-day people. With more moms and dads working non-traditional hours or independent jobs, the traditional 9-5 daycare design no further fit their particular schedules. Furthermore, numerous people discovered it difficult to secure inexpensive and dependable childcare on quick notice, particularly in problems or unexpected circumstances.

Drop-in daycare centers filled this gap by providing versatile hours, no reservation needs, and affordable prices. They provided a safe and nurturing environment for the kids while allowing moms and dads to attend meetings, operate errands, or simply just take a much-needed break. Thus, drop-in daycare rapidly became a popular selection for busy families shopping for convenient and reliable childcare solutions.

Difficulties and possibilities

While drop-in daycare facilities like ABC Drop-In Daycare have proven to be successful, they also face numerous challenges in satisfying the requirements of households and remaining competitive available in the market. One of the main challenges is ensuring a sufficient staff-to-child proportion to keep up a safe and supporting environment for many children. This can be tough during top hours or whenever unanticipated demand occurs, needing centers becoming versatile and creative within their staffing techniques.

Another challenge for drop-in daycare facilities is managing the fluctuating demand for solutions each day and week. While many days are busier than the others, facilities needs to be ready to accommodate all young ones within their attention and offer quality services all of the time. This requires careful scheduling and coordination to make sure that staff and resources are allocated effortlessly.

Despite these challenges, drop-in daycare centers have several possibilities for growth and development. Aided by the increasing interest in versatile childcare choices, there was an ever growing market for providers who can meet up with the needs of modern-day people. By offering revolutionary services, such as long hours, weekend care, or special activities, facilities can attract new customers and differentiate on their own from rivals.

Furthermore, drop-in daycare facilities possess potential to create partnerships with neighborhood businesses, schools, and neighborhood organizations to expand their reach and provide additional solutions. By working together along with other stakeholders, facilities can cause a network of help for families and offer an extensive variety of childcare options for town.
